Beyond the mall: Pop-ups, craft fairs and other holiday shopping

Looking to shop someplace a bit different this year? Here’s a sampling of pop-up shops, holiday sidewalk sales, major craft festivals and other events for your shopping pleasure.

Ongoing: Handmade ceramics, hand-painted scarves, jewelry and more work by local artists are at the Space art center. Ends Dec. 24. 1506 Mission St., South Pasadena. (626) 441-4788.

Ongoing: The Huntington Library, Art Collections, and Botanical Gardens hosts holiday trunk shows every weekend until Christmas. Selection includes ceramics, herbal bath and skin care products, jewelry, art books and children’s games. 1151 Oxford Road, San Marino. Parking and admission to shopping are free. (626) 405-2100.

Nov. 30: Artspace Warehouse, Modernica, Gibson (shown above), Bourgeois Boheme, Blend Interiors, Mosaik, Rummage, Espionage and other stores along the 7000 block of Beverly Boulevard in Los Angeles host an evening of shopping specials, gift wrapping and refreshments during Beverly Boulevard Night Out. 5 to 8 p.m. (323) 934-4248.

Dec. 1: West Elm hosts an Etsy craft event from 6 to 9 p.m. Customers can create Christmas ornaments for trees that will be donated to local charities. Five local Etsy vendors sell their crafts. 8366 Beverly Blvd., Los Angeles; (323) 782-9672. Also, 1433 4th St., Santa Monica; (310) 576-7270.

Dec. 2-4: More than 100 dealers at the Sherman Oaks Antique Mall offer wine, cheese, door prizes and discounts up to 50% off at the 24th annual Holiday Open House. 14034 Ventura Blvd., Sherman Oaks. (818) 906-0338.

Dec. 3: The Craft and Folk Art Museum hosts a global bazaar featuring handmade and fair trade goods. 10 a.m. to 4 p.m. Free. The museum store has extended shopping hours from 5 to 8 p.m. Dec 7 to 9. 5814 Wilshire Blvd., Los Angeles (323) 937-4230.

Dec. 3: The Los Feliz Village Holiday Festival includes complimentary trolley to transport shoppers through Hillhurst and Vermont avenues and Hollywood Boulevard. Carolers, puppeteers and Santa. 6 to 10 p.m. Sponsored by the Los Feliz Village Business Improvement District and village merchants and restaurants. Free.

Dec. 3: A French-inspired artist and vintage market held the first Saturday of each month, 11 a.m. to 6 p.m., to benefit Hollywood High School. The event is held in the school parking lot. The market organizers pay rent for the space, plus give 50 cents of each $2 admission to the school, at Sunset Boulevard and Highland Avenue.

Dec. 3-4: Mexican fine art and folk art including Mata Ortiz pottery, Oaxacan wood carvings and Zapotec Indian rugs are featured at this holiday event. 11 a.m. to 6 p.m. Dec. 3; 11 a.m. to 4 p.m. Dec. 4. Melrose Lightspace Studio, 7600 Melrose Ave., Suite N, Los Angeles. (323) 651-3893.

Dec. 3-4: The fourth annual Unique L.A. holiday craft show features more than 300 vendors of handmade art, stationery, home accessories, jewelry and clothes. The event includes DIY workshops. 11 a.m. to 6 p.m. $10. California Market Center, 110 E. 9th St., Los Angeles.

Dec. 4: Rancho Santa Ana Botanic Garden’s Winter Holiday Open House features gifts, gift wrapping, live music, crafts and a visit with Santa. 9 a.m. to 3 p.m. Free. 1500 N. College Ave., Claremont. (909) 625-8767.

Dec. 9-10: More than 20 local artists sell their works at the Clayhouse annual sale. 4 to 9 p.m. Dec. 9, 10 a.m. to 7 p.m. Dec. 10. Free. 2909 Santa Monica Blvd., Santa Monica. (310) 828-7071.

Dec. 10: The Pelican Courtyard Flea Market for new and vintage finds takes place from 9 a.m. to 1 p.m. on the second Saturday of the month. Free. 124 Tustin Ave., Newport Beach.

Dec. 10-11: Bauer Pottery, above, hosts its annual sale of factory seconds and samples up to 60% off retail prices. 9 a.m. to 5 p.m. 3051 Rosslyn St., Los Angeles. (818) 500-0666.

Dec. 10-11: More than 200 vendors sell handmade wares at the second annual Renegade Craft Fair Holiday Market, right. 10 a.m. to 5 p.m. Free. Los Angeles State Historic Park, 1245 N. Spring St., Los Angeles.

Dec. 10-11: Descanso Gardens volunteers sell handmade items at the Holiday Craft Boutique. 10 a.m. to 4 p.m. Included in regular gardens admission of $3 to $8. 1418 Descanso Drive, La Cañada Flintridge. (818) 949-4200.

Dec. 11: The Rose Bowl Flea Market and Market Place holds its last event before Christmas. Regular admission runs from 9 a.m. to 4:30 p.m. and costs $8. Express admission starts at 8 a.m. and costs $10. Early admission starts at 7 a.m. and costs $15. VIP admission starts at 5 a.m. and costs $20. Box office closes at 3 p.m. Rose Bowl, 1001 Rose Bowl Drive, Pasadena.

Dec. 18: Long Beach Antique Mart stages its last sale before Christmas. Hundreds of vendors. Regular admission runs from 6:30 a.m. to 2 p.m. and costs $5. Early admission starts at 5:30 a.m. and costs $10. Long Beach Veterans Stadium, 4901 E. Conant St., Long Beach.
